Abstract: 

Board members control family foundations and are charged with responsibility under federal and state law for the effective operation of those foundations. Anyone joining a nonprofit board—whether a family foundation or public charity—should be concerned about personal liability. One of the best ways to manage liability is to use a checklist. The three checklists presented here provide guidance for new board members (to be reviewed before they agree to join the family foundation board), existing board members (to review their annual participation in foundation activities), and for the board as a whole (to review the foundation manager’s operations compliance).
